Backflow plumbing replacement services involve removing and installing new backflow prevention devices to ensure the safety and integrity of a property's water supply. These services typically include inspecting existing backflow preventers, removing outdated or damaged units, and installing new equipment that meets local plumbing codes. Professionals handling these replacements ensure that the devices are properly connected and tested to prevent any potential contamination of the potable water system. Proper installation and replacement are essential for maintaining a reliable and safe water supply, especially in areas with strict plumbing regulations.
These services address common problems such as device failure, wear and tear, or damage caused by freezing, corrosion, or physical impact. Over time, backflow preventers can become less effective or malfunction, posing risks of contaminated water entering the clean water supply. Replacement services help resolve these issues by upgrading outdated or damaged equipment, reducing the risk of health hazards, and ensuring compliance with local water safety standards. Regular replacement also helps prevent costly repairs or water damage caused by leaks or device failure.

Replacement Costs - Backflow plumbing replacement typically costs between $1,000 and $3,500, depending on the system size and complexity. For example, a standard residential backflow device may fall around $1,200 to $2,000. Costs can vary based on local labor rates and specific project requirements.
Material Expenses - The price of materials for backflow replacement generally ranges from $300 to $1,000. The selection of materials, such as brass or bronze, influences the overall cost. Higher-quality or specialized materials may increase the total expense.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for backflow plumbing replacement usually range from $500 to $2,000. The duration of the work and accessibility of the installation site are factors that can impact labor charges. Local contractor rates also play a role in the final price.
Additional Charges - Extra costs, such as permit fees or system testing, can add $100 to $500 to the project. These charges depend on local regulations and the scope of the replacement. It’s advisable to contact local pros for det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is backflow plumbing replacement? Backflow plumbing replacement involves removing and installing new backflow prevention devices to ensure that contaminated water does not flow back into the clean water supply.
When should backflow prevention devices be replaced? These devices should be replaced if they are damaged, malfunctioning, or have reached the end of their recommended service life, as advised by local plumbing standards.
How can I tell if my backflow prevention device needs replacing? Signs may include leaks, reduced water pressure, or failure to pass inspection tests; a professional can assess whether replacement is necessary.
